Internal Memo — Dellbrook Retail Pilot

To the incoming director: the pilot with the Dellbrook chain launches in six of their stores next month, featuring the Ashline product range. Success metrics are sell-through rate and return frequency over twelve weeks. Merchandising materials ship next week. Results will determine whether we pursue the full rollout. The confidential plan behind this pilot appears below.

board note of bawep-tajef: Queniusek Systems plans to raise the Quenvan list price by 53.1 percent in March. The pricing group signed off on a budget of $176.4 million for Project Drueth. The renewal with Casionix Partners closes at $142.5 million a year, 8.3 percent below the last contract. Project Fraax slips by six weeks because of the tooling delay.

/*
 * RestockPilot client setup — for external plugin authors.
 * This client talks to the Corridor restock-planning API: it pulls
 * machine inventory snapshots, predicts sell-through, and returns a
 * suggested restock route. Plugins must call init() before any
 * planner methods. Rate limit: 60 req/min per plugin. Sandbox data
 * only; production machines are off-limits. Initialize the client
 * with the key below.
 */

API key for bahop-yajog: qvz3-mhf

14:22 — Offline sync regression confirmed (Terrapath field-survey app)

At 14:22 the on-call engineer reproduced the data-loss path: surveys saved while offline were marked synced once connectivity returned, even when the upload was rejected. The queue flush skipped the server acknowledgement check introduced in the previous sprint. Release manager note: the fix must ship before the coastal survey season. The offending build is identified by the token recorded below.

session token of kawif-fawig = htk31_f3f599be2b1a34affb1efa8d0feccf8

CI Troubleshooting: Telemetry Payload Compression

Hey plugin folks — if your Skylark CI runs started failing at the telemetry upload step, it's probably the new compression gate. The collector now rejects uncompressed payloads over 64 KB, so wrap your metrics blob with the bundled zstd helper before posting. Don't double-compress; the gateway will flag it as corrupt and retry forever. If you're still stuck, grab the failing run and compare it against the reference build. The known-good token is right below this note.

pipeline stamp: htk31_f769b577b3028a4e9958e5bb8d1259a